The verdict · 2018 Week 14
Cleveland Browns 26, Panthers 20 — with the result never quite settled.
It turned at Q4 14:13, 3rd and 2, on Jarvis Landry — 19.3 win-probability points to the Browns on one snap, the largest move of the game.

What separated them
Red zone
Browns won this one — 2 touchdowns on 3 trips, against Panthers at 2 touchdowns on 5 trips.
Brownsthe gap went the way the scoreboard did
Third down
Browns won this one — 4 of 9 on third down, against Panthers at 5 of 14 on third down.
Brownsthe gap went the way the scoreboard did
Running the ball
Browns won this one — +0.21 expected points per carry, against Panthers at +0.11 expected points per carry.
Brownsthe gap went the way the scoreboard did
Explosive plays
Panthers owned this one and still lost it — 7 chunk plays, against Browns at 6 chunk plays.
Panthersthe gap went the other way from the scoreboard

Nick Chubb's 4-yard rushing touchdown with 13:10 left in the 4th put Cleveland Browns ahead for good. The lead never changed over the 1 score that followed.

high through week 14Against their seasonFourth Down
CAR's fourth-and-short go rate, 75.0%, is past their previous high of 33.3% in week 2 — the highest of their 7 charted games through week 14.
4 fourth-and-short calls this game, floor 3 — 8 of their games behind the ruler, and their own week-to-week swing is 19.8 points.
CLE's early-down pass rate turned over: 78.0% in week 13 against 55.9% here — they passed early then and ran early now, a turn of 2.6 of their own weekly swings across the two.
34 early downs this game, floor 15 — 16 of their games behind the ruler, and their own week-to-week swing is 8.4 points.
